"Birria-Landia makes the city’s best birria, full stop. This Tijuana-style spot is a New York City landmark, like the Statue of Liberty, except it’s a truck under a set of subway tracks in Jackson Heights, and it’s much less of a hassle to get to. (They have four more locations, including Williamsburg.) Each of the items on their menu—tacos, mulitas, tostadas, and consomme—is bolstered by tangy, mildly spicy, and mysteriously deep stew. First, you’ll taste lime, then tender meat, then adobo, then dripping fat, with everything melting together in your unworthy mouth. Make sure to dip your crunchy-soft, beef-filled tortilla in your cup of consomme. The word “delicious” seems somehow inadequate." - hannah albertine, nikko duren, carlo mantuano, will hartman
